The canton of Saint-Malo-2 is an administrative division of the Ille-et-Vilaine department, in northwestern France. It was created at the French canton reorganisation which came into effect in March 2015. Its seat is in Saint-Malo.[2]
It consists of the following communes:[2]
- Dinard
- Le Minihic-sur-Rance
- Pleurtuit
- La Richardais
- Saint-Briac-sur-Mer
- Saint-Jouan-des-Guérets
- Saint-Lunaire
- Saint-Malo (partly)
